Planning Details below are of a planning application and listed building consent which was permitted for the residential conversion of the upper floors to two dwellings. The consents have lapsed, but the attached links include plans and relevant documentation on the buildings required for the planning permission. Tenure – Long Leasehold Interest/Freehold Interest The property is stated to be held for a term of 500 years created by a Lease dated “on or about” the 20th March 1579 made between Queen Elizabeth I and the Earl of Derby at a peppercorn rent. The Land Registry entry states that “Neither the original instrument creating the term, nor a certified copy, or examined abstract thereof, was produced on first registration.” As a result, we have not been able to identify any unusual or onerous covenants running with the land. We are informed that the current long leaseholders have put in place a Defective Title Indemnity Policy having a Maximum Liability of £1,090,000. (Full details are available from White Commercial). How many commercial properties are currently available for sale in Oxfordshire?
There are currently 67 commercial properties available for sale. Sizes range from 297 sq ft to 31,539 sq ft, with an average size of 3,840 sq ft. Available opportunities may include offices, retail premises, industrial properties, mixed-use assets and development sites.
How much does commercial property cost in Oxfordshire?
The average asking price is approximately £285 per sq ft, with prices ranging from £55 to £2,538 per sq ft. Property values will vary depending on location, size, condition, tenant status and market demand.
What factors influence commercial property values?
Property values can be affected by location, building quality, asset size, lease terms, tenant covenant strength, redevelopment potential and local market conditions. For investment properties, income generation and yield are also important considerations.
What types of commercial property are available to buy?
The market may include offices, retail units, industrial properties, warehouses, land, mixed-use buildings and specialist assets. Availability will vary depending on location and current market conditions.
What should I consider before buying commercial property?
Key considerations include location, accessibility, property condition, planning permissions, lease arrangements, operating costs and future growth potential. Buyers should also understand any legal, environmental or structural issues that could affect value or usability.
What is rental yield and why does it matter?
Rental yield measures the income generated by a property relative to its purchase price. Investors often use yield to compare opportunities, although it should be considered alongside factors such as tenant quality, lease length and potential for capital growth.
Can I buy commercial property for my own business?
Yes. Many buyers purchase commercial property to occupy themselves rather than as an investment. Owning premises can provide greater control over operating costs, security of tenure and the potential to benefit from future capital appreciation.
Do I need a commercial mortgage?
Many buyers use commercial finance to fund acquisitions. Deposit requirements, lending terms and borrowing costs vary depending on the property, the buyer's circumstances and the intended use of the asset.
What due diligence should I carry out before buying?
Due diligence typically includes reviewing title documents, planning permissions, leases, service charge information, environmental matters and building condition reports. Professional legal and surveying advice is strongly recommended before completing a purchase.
What are the risks of buying commercial property?
Potential risks include market fluctuations, vacancy periods, tenant default, maintenance costs, planning restrictions and changes in local demand. Thorough due diligence and effective asset management can help reduce these risks.
Can overseas buyers purchase commercial property in the UK?
Yes. International buyers can purchase commercial property in the UK, although additional legal, tax and regulatory considerations may apply. Professional advice should be obtained before proceeding with a transaction.
What additional costs should I budget for?
In addition to the purchase price, buyers should budget for Stamp Duty Land Tax, legal fees, surveys, finance costs, insurance and any refurbishment or fit-out works that may be required.
